在数据分析技术不断发展的今天,如何保障数据隐私安全成了企业和个人极为关注的话题。数据分析技术不仅能帮助企业更好地了解市场和用户行为,还能提高运营效率,但与此同时,数据隐私安全问题也变得愈发重要。本文将从数据加密、访问控制、数据匿名化、数据屏蔽等几个方面详细探讨数据分析技术如何保障数据隐私安全。
本文核心要点:
- 数据加密:保护数据传输和存储的安全
- 访问控制:确保只有授权人员才能访问数据
- 数据匿名化:隐藏个人身份信息
- 数据屏蔽:限制敏感数据的可见性
通过这些技术手段,企业可以有效地保障数据隐私安全,避免数据泄露,提升用户信任度。
一、数据加密
数据加密是保障数据隐私安全的基础技术之一。它通过将明文数据转换为密文数据,确保即使数据被盗取,也无法被轻易解读或使用。数据加密分为两种类型:对称加密和非对称加密。
1. 对称加密技术
对称加密技术是指在加密和解密过程中使用相同的密钥。这种技术的优点是加密速度快,适合大规模数据的加密。常见的对称加密算法有AES(高级加密标准)和DES(数据加密标准)。
- 加密速度快,适合大规模数据
- 密钥管理复杂,需要安全地存储和传递密钥
对称加密技术在实际应用中需要特别注意密钥的管理,因为一旦密钥泄露,数据也将不再安全。企业可以通过密钥管理系统(KMS)来确保密钥的安全存储和传递。
2. 非对称加密技术
非对称加密技术使用一对公钥和私钥进行加密和解密。公钥用于加密数据,私钥用于解密数据。这种技术的优点是解决了密钥传递的安全问题,但加密速度相对较慢。常见的非对称加密算法有RSA和ECC(椭圆曲线加密)。
- 解决了密钥传递的安全问题
- 加密速度较慢,适用于小数据量或密钥交换
通过合理选择和组合对称加密和非对称加密技术,企业可以在保障数据隐私安全的同时,提升数据传输和存储的效率。
二、访问控制
访问控制是指通过严格的权限管理,确保只有授权人员才能访问数据。这一技术手段可以有效防止未经授权的访问和数据泄露。访问控制主要包括身份认证和权限管理两个方面。
1. 身份认证
身份认证是访问控制的第一道防线,通过验证用户的身份,确保只有合法用户才能访问系统。常见的身份认证方法有密码认证、双因素认证和生物识别认证。
- 密码认证:使用用户名和密码进行身份验证
- 双因素认证:在密码基础上增加一次性验证码,提高安全性
- 生物识别认证:通过指纹、面部识别等生物特征进行身份验证
企业可以根据数据敏感度和安全需求,采用不同的身份认证方法,确保用户身份的唯一性和真实性。
2. 权限管理
权限管理是在身份认证的基础上,进一步细化用户的访问权限,确保用户只能访问其权限范围内的数据。常见的权限管理方式有基于角色的访问控制(RBAC)和基于属性的访问控制(ABAC)。
- RBAC:根据用户角色分配权限,简化权限管理
- ABAC:根据用户属性和环境条件动态分配权限,提高灵活性
通过合理的权限管理,企业可以有效防止数据滥用和泄露,保障数据隐私安全。
三、数据匿名化
数据匿名化是指通过技术手段,将数据中的个人身份信息进行隐藏或去除,从而在不影响数据分析结果的前提下,保护数据隐私。数据匿名化技术主要包括数据脱敏和数据伪装。
1. 数据脱敏
数据脱敏是指通过对敏感信息进行删除或替换,达到保护隐私的目的。常见的数据脱敏方法有字符脱敏、数值脱敏和遮盖脱敏。
- 字符脱敏:将敏感字符替换为特定符号,如将身份证号中的部分数字替换为“*”
- 数值脱敏:对敏感数值进行模糊处理,如将具体的年龄替换为年龄段
- 遮盖脱敏:对敏感信息进行部分遮盖,如只显示银行卡号的后四位
数据脱敏技术可以在保证数据可用性的同时,保护个人隐私,适用于各种数据分析场景。
2. 数据伪装
数据伪装是指通过生成虚假数据来替代真实数据,从而保护数据隐私。常见的数据伪装方法有随机化和仿真数据生成。
- 随机化:将数据打乱或添加随机噪声,保护数据隐私
- 仿真数据生成:根据数据模式生成虚假数据,替代真实数据
数据伪装技术可以在不影响数据分析结果的前提下,提供高度的隐私保护,适用于敏感数据的处理和分析。
四、数据屏蔽
数据屏蔽是指通过限制敏感数据的可见性,确保只有特定用户或应用才能访问敏感数据。数据屏蔽技术主要包括数据分级和数据分区。
1. 数据分级
数据分级是指根据数据的敏感度,将数据分为不同的级别,并根据用户的权限级别,控制其访问权限。常见的数据分级方法有数据标签和数据分类。
- 数据标签:为数据打上不同的标签,根据标签控制访问权限
- 数据分类:将数据分为不同的类别,根据类别控制访问权限
通过数据分级,企业可以有效控制敏感数据的访问权限,防止数据泄露。
2. 数据分区
数据分区是指将数据按不同的维度进行分区,并根据用户的权限,控制其访问不同的数据分区。常见的数据分区方法有水平分区和垂直分区。
- 水平分区:将数据按行进行分区,如按地域、时间等维度分区
- 垂直分区:将数据按列进行分区,如将敏感信息和非敏感信息分开存储
通过数据分区,企业可以精细化控制数据的访问权限,保障数据隐私安全。
总结
数据分析技术在保障数据隐私安全方面发挥着重要作用。通过数据加密、访问控制、数据匿名化和数据屏蔽等技术手段,企业可以有效地保护数据隐私,防止数据泄露。特别是在选择企业数据分析工具时,FineBI是一款值得推荐的解决方案。它不仅提供强大的数据分析功能,还具备完善的数据安全保护机制,帮助企业实现高效、安全的数据分析。
推荐使用FineBI进行企业数据分析,点击下方链接立即体验:
本文相关FAQs
数据分析技术如何保障数据隐私安全?
数据隐私安全是当前企业在进行大数据分析时最为关注的问题之一。现代数据分析技术在保护用户隐私方面发挥了重要作用。以下是一些常见的保障数据隐私安全的方法:
- 数据加密:通过加密技术将敏感数据进行加密处理,确保即使数据被窃取,攻击者也无法解密和读取数据。
- 访问控制:严格控制谁能访问数据,采用身份验证和授权机制,确保只有经过授权的人员能够访问敏感数据。
- 数据匿名化:将数据进行匿名化处理,移除或替换能够识别个人身份的信息,使数据在分析过程中无法直接关联到个人。
- 差分隐私:通过在数据集中添加噪声,使得单个数据点的存在或不存在不会显著影响整体分析结果,从而保障个体隐私。
- 定期审计:实施定期的安全审计和监控,及时发现和应对潜在的安全威胁和漏洞。
数据加密在数据隐私保护中的作用是什么?
数据加密是保障数据隐私安全的核心技术之一。通过将原始数据转换为密文,只有拥有正确解密密钥的人才能还原数据。这样,即使数据在传输或存储过程中被截获,未经授权的人也无法读取数据内容。数据加密在保护敏感数据(如用户个人信息、财务数据等)方面尤为重要。
加密技术分为对称加密和非对称加密两种。对称加密使用相同的密钥进行加密和解密,速度快但密钥管理复杂;非对称加密使用公钥和私钥对,公钥加密、私钥解密,适合在不安全的网络环境中使用。
访问控制如何确保数据只有授权人员能够访问?
访问控制通过身份验证和授权机制,确保只有经过授权的人员才能访问数据。常见的身份验证方式包括密码验证、双因素认证、生物识别等。授权机制则通过角色和权限管理,规定不同角色可以访问的数据范围和操作权限。
例如,企业可以通过定义不同的用户角色(如管理员、分析师、普通用户),为每个角色分配不同的数据访问权限,严格控制数据访问路径,避免敏感数据泄露。
此外,应用细粒度的访问控制策略,可以进一步细化到具体的数据字段和操作,确保数据访问的安全性和灵活性。
数据匿名化在数据分析中的应用场景有哪些?
数据匿名化是通过移除或替换能够识别个人身份的信息,使数据在分析过程中无法直接关联到个人。这种技术在需要使用真实数据进行分析但又要保护个人隐私的场景中广泛应用。
- 医疗数据分析:在分析患者数据时,通过匿名化处理,确保患者的个人信息不会泄露。
- 金融数据分析:在进行金融行为分析时,通过匿名化技术保护客户的财务隐私。
- 用户行为分析:在研究用户行为和偏好时,使用匿名化数据避免侵犯用户隐私。
数据匿名化不仅保护了个人隐私,还能在一定程度上提升数据分析的合规性和数据共享的安全性。
如何平衡数据隐私保护与数据分析需求?
在保障数据隐私安全的同时,企业也需要充分利用数据进行分析,以支持业务决策。平衡数据隐私保护与数据分析需求是一项挑战,但并非不可实现。
- 数据最小化原则:尽量收集和使用与分析目的相关的最少数据,避免不必要的数据暴露。
- 加密和匿名化技术:通过加密和匿名化技术,在保证数据隐私的同时,仍能进行有效的数据分析。
- 合规性审查:确保数据分析过程符合相关法律法规和行业标准,避免侵犯用户隐私。
- 透明度和用户授权:增加数据处理的透明度,获得用户的明确授权,增强用户对数据使用的信任。
使用先进的数据分析工具,如帆软的FineBI在线免费试用,可以帮助企业在保障数据隐私的同时,实现高效的数据分析和决策支持。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。